Review of chemistry for renewable energy

Baidildina Aizhan

The instructor profile

Description: Chemical conversion processes are considered that make it possible to produce energy based on renewable energy sources. The main electrochemical, thermodynamic properties of materials and substances, physicochemical, technological indicators are studied; properties of renewable energy sources used at energy facilities; methods of managing the quality of a renewable resource in the process of energy production.
